MsgConnecting Desktops and Mobile Devices
First of all, what do we name a framework? We anticipate a common code that offers popular functionality and may be selectively overridden or extended with the aid of consumer code to offer particular functionality. The framework is a special case of a software library, and its key capabilities are reusability and a well-described API.
Second, we need to don’t forget to talk about approximately a cellular device? Most of them are smart telephones, PDAs (Personal Digital Assistant), pill computer systems, and netbooks.
Talking about PDA, we have to say a collection of EDA, Enterprise Digital Assistants, which might be very just like PDA, however in some feel are more particular, designed and programmed for certain enterprise obligations, frequently offering included facts capture devices like barcode and smart card readers.
Most PDAs are operating on specialized running structures, a number of them of Windows own family (e.G. WindowsCE, Windows Mobile, Windows PocketPC, Windows XP Tablet Edition), others on Linux, Palm, and many others, for clever phones very famous are Android and BlackBerry working structures.
Taking all this in thoughts, we will call a cell device a few surprisingly small laptops that certainly work on one of the systems cited above. Though now and again you may hear or read speculations about pocketbook vs. Desktop pc, in this newsletter, we don’t assume a conventional pocketbook to be a cell device; rather, we can refer to it like a desktop.
Read More Article :
- Will Mobile Devices Soon Be the Dominant Channel for Payment Transactions?
- Relationship Connections: Tethered to a Mobile Device
- Benefits of Using Pet Mobility Devices
- Get Your Existing Products Into the Mobile Market
- Mobile Broadband Offers Anytime Access to News and More
Let’s believe that you need to increase the software enterprise level for handling something like a plant, business office, or inn! Why motel? Why no longer. Everybody knows something about the motel, and no person knows the whole lot. Its era is complex enough to use a maximum of the cell gadgets mentioned in the previous section. For instance, you will want to create a database, and a maximum of mobile devices (EDAs of motel non-public) will communicate to it. The hotel desires a sturdy protection machine to identify its personnel and check their entry to rights for this. This system is logical to be applied on statistics capture gadgets included in EDAs, like fingerprint scanners.
It may be very in all likelihood that our lodge does not appear to be a super one in traveler enterprise experience, but please do not bother about it. We want this hotel not to experience a holiday but to illustrate the competencies of MsgConnect, which can be a lot better.
What Do You Have to Care About?
First, you have to design a database, and of direction, it’s going to now not live on the mobile tool, remember putting it someplace in a dependable vicinity. Maybe use cloud storage? This database will hold the whole thing about your lodge, from real visitors and reservations to vacant rooms to drinks and foods to be had and required.
We will not bother approximately business good judgment of the device; however, you have to consider loads of desktops or notebooks for high-stage managers in places of work. From time to time, they may make requests to the database, something like: “How many vacant rooms will we have for now? Is it sufficient scotch on inventory? What is the traveler NN test out date?”
And ultimately, don’t forget approximately mobile devices! Each hostess should have an EDA, and every bartender as properly, with a barcode or clever card readers to be had. Some of the security men probably could have EDA with an automated identity machine embedded.
Not to say a climate control, which ought to be of direction computerized and driven through cellular gadgets with embedded structures, but once in a while, a few accountable man or woman need to have an opportunity to interfere in its capability, optionally from a laptop or EDA.
PDAs and EDAs are available on selecting various platforms like clones of Windows (e.G. WindowsCE, Windows Mobile, Windows PocketPC, Windows XP Tablet Edition), Linux, Palm, and others. A wonderful part of smart telephones is running on the Android and BlackBerry operating systems.
You’ll likely have to deal with numerous extraordinary structures. You hardly ever can control all these items on unmarried or on few related platforms; manifestly, this can make the undertaking of speaking between computer systems no longer trivial.
PDA Operating System providers usually offer a manner for synchronizing records among laptop operating structures and their products. However, there are numerous critical barriers. Fortunately, MsgConnect gives you the manner to conquer these boundaries.
MsgConnect is based on the idea of exchanging messages – blocks of facts that have a fixed part with predefined fields and optionally have a data part. Using messages, you may ship instructions to different strategies, obtain replies, switch the records across more than one strategies and do lots of different beneficial matters.
Having taken the idea from the Windows Messaging subsystem, MsgConnect but isn’t restricted to Windows simplest. MsgConnect became correctly ported to unique systems.
There are to be had implementations for Windows, Android, BlackBerry, Linux, FreeBSD, QNX, Windows CE/ PocketPC, JavaT (SE/EE, ME), and.NET structures. More platforms are to return.
How Can You Manage?
It’s no longer clean. It’s tough to attach dozens of computers working on specific platforms and lead them to speak to every other until you are the usage of MsgConnect.
MsgConnect (examine Message-Connect) simplifies your utility development drastically with the aid of looking after all of the low-stage tasks for you. It was designed to be small, fast, and effective, and at the same time to offer an entire career. With MsgConnect, you might not write and painfully check multithreaded server code; you won’t need to split the facts move into messages, and dispatch those messages. All your efforts may be directed at commercial enterprise common sense whilst MsgConnect takes care of statistics and messages transfer.
Naturally, a number of the tasks for your in management can be finished using traditional purchaser-server technology, for instance, most of the requests to database concerning inventory fee of something, booking of rooms, etc.
Client-server architecture won sizable location in modern-day networking due to ease of logical corporation and preservation. The idea of a conversation between a client and a server is not tough to layout, create and report.
However, from a technical point of view advent of effective server software can be an extended and painful procedure. The matters can turn out to be a whole lot worse if the server needs to send the unrequested facts to the customer, i.E. Act as a purchaser itself. To this degree, one has to remodel the complete protocol stack to feature such an opportunity.
MsgConnect dramatically simplifies the data alternate technique via imparting a bendy and green messaging paradigm by supplying an impartial bi-directional verbal exchange through a single connection (you cut up one connection into it). Moreover, MsgConnect affords an easy manner to create event-pushed communications between clients and servers, and the sort of scheme is commonly more smooth to layout and is a great deal extra scalable.